What is the cheapest month to fly from BWI to KEF with Delta Air Lines?
Delta Air Lines flights to Reykjavik are generally more affordable in the low-season months of January and April. Whether you’re after a round-trip or one-way ticket, you could score a better deal then.
What is the cheapest time to book flights from Baltimore Washington Intl. Thurgood Marshall Airport (BWI) to Keflavik Intl. Airport (KEF) with Delta Air Lines?
To find affordable flights from BWI to KEF with Delta Air Lines, begin searching about one month before your intended departure. You can save 17% when you lock in your international tickets 18 to 29 days ahead instead of booking four to five months in advance. Another helpful tip? Booking on Sunday offers average savings of 17% compared to Friday (the most expensive day).**Ideal booking window recommendation is based on average round-trip ticket prices for January through November for 2024. Best day of the week to book recommendation is based on average round-trip ticket prices for January through October 2024. All data sourced from ARC’s global airline sales database.
